Cortex Wrinkles
The folds and grooves on the surface of the cerebral cortex that increase its surface area, allowing for a greater number of neurons and higher cognitive functions.
Occipital Lobes
The region of the brain located at the back of the head, responsible for processing visual information.
Visual Cortex
The visual cortex is the part of the brain that processes visual information, enabling the perception of shapes, colors, and motion.
Mirror System
A network of neurons in the brain that is thought to be involved in understanding the actions of others, empathy, and learning through imitation.
